У меня проблемы с подключением к PDO.
Я пытаюсь подключить телефон на базе Android к базе данных Raspberry PI 3.
У меня есть в папке PI / var / www / html / некоторые файлы php.
Один из них управляет подключением к базе данных.
Я пытался подключиться через phpmyadmin с помощью имени пользователя и пароля, и он отлично работает на Pi и других компьютерах в сети.
<?php
function connexionPDO()
{
$login = "XXXXXX";
$mdp = "YYYYYYYYYYY";
$bd = "ZZZZZZ";
$serveur = "192.168.0.12";
$port = "3307";
try
{
echo "tentative de connexion BWAAAAAAA";
$conn = new PDO("mysql:host=$serveur;dbname=$bd", $login, $mdp);
echo "BWA connexion reussie";
return $conn;
}
catch(PDOException $e)
{
echo "BWA errrrreuuuuuur";
print "Erreur !%".$e->getMessage();
die();
}
}
?>
В LogCat в Android Studio я получаю:
BWA errrruuuuuuurErreur!% SQLSTATE [HY000] [2002] Соединение отклонено
Может кто-нибудь объяснить мне, где проблема?
ти
Эво